<strong>Cranford</strong> <strong>Police</strong> <strong>Department</strong> <strong>Annual</strong> Click It or Ticket Mobilization<br />
The <strong>Cranford</strong> <strong>Police</strong> <strong>Department</strong> received $4,000 in grant money from the New Jersey Division of<br />
Highway Traffic Safety for seatbelt enforcement during the national “Click It or Ticket” campaign. The<br />
goal of the program is to increase seatbelt usage rates through education and enforcement.<br />
New Jersey reported 554 fatalities in 2010, a large percentage of which were not wearing a seatbelt.<br />
Also, seatbelt use is especially important for teens and young adults, as motor vehicle crashes are the<br />
leading cause of death for people ages 15 to 34 in the United States.<br />
This year’s “Click It or Ticket” Mobilization was conducted from May 23, <strong>2011</strong> to June 5, <strong>2011</strong>. The<br />
department conducted four seat belt checkpoints and 55 hours of focused roving patrols utilizing<br />
overtime, patrol, and traffic personnel. In addition, we conducted 22 hours of night time enforcement<br />
due to statistics pointing to very low seat belt use in the evening. A total of 80 hours of overtime were<br />
utilized, which was reimbursed by the grant. Below is a summary of the department’s enforcement<br />
efforts.<br />
Total Seatbelt Violations: 116<br />
All Other Violations: 237<br />
TOTAL SUMMONSES DURING THE MOBILIZATION: 353<br />
In addition to the summonses issued arrests included 23 for drug possession and/or felony/warrant<br />
arrests. A post survey of seat belt usage showed a 97% <strong>com</strong>pliance rate on <strong>Cranford</strong> roadways.<br />
